Business Development Manager | Timber Packaging | UK | Up to £60k

A UK based specialist in bespoke timber and plywood packaging solutions, trusted for decades by businesses across a wide range of industries including automotive, industrial and medical sectors. The company prides itself on combining deep technical expertise with tailored design and robust manufacturing to deliver high-quality, performance-driven packaging that meets exact specifications and compliance standards. With a focus on reliability, craftsmanship and customer service, they ensure every solution is built to safeguard products, whether fragile, heavy or irregularly shaped, wherever they need to go.

You

will be responsible for:
  • Identifying, developing, and securing new business opportunities across manufacturing, packaging, and merchant sectors to drive sustainable revenue growth
  • Building and maintaining strong relationships with key clients to position the company as a preferred timber packaging supplier
  • Managing the full sales cycle, from prospecting and specification through to quotation, negotiation, and closing, ensuring a seamless customer experience
  • Developing strategic account plans to maximise account value through proactive upselling, strengthen retention, and drive long-term partnership growth
  • Monitoring market trends, competitor activity, and pricing to inform commercial strategy and maximise margin opportunities
Key attributes required:
  • Proven track record of winning new business and consistently delivering against sales targets
  • Strong commercial awareness with the ability to identify profitable opportunities and negotiate effectively
  • In-depth knowledge of timber packaging products
  • Exceptional relationship-building skills with the confidence to engage stakeholders at all levels
  • Collaborative mindset with the ability to work cross-functionally to deliver outstanding customer outcomes
